i bought 1U Supermicro with X9SCL-F Intel Xeon E3-1220 8GB to keep as VM backup server for 4 host proxmox cluster.
the server has 6 sata ports onboard from which 4 (0-1) are connected to the 4 bay hd backplane. when i connect a ssd to one of the two remaining ports the HD gets recognized by the BIOS but i can't select is as a boot device. It only allows me to select one of the drives hooked up to the backplane, but i'd like to use the 4 bay for JBOD zfs config. anyone know if there's some workaround for it or is usb boot my only option ?

just an update. i flashed the latest bios for this motherboard and it appears to be working. SSD as boot (inside case) and 2 x 2TB (on a 4 bay backplane) in mirror for data on freenas 9.10. yes it was strange but i'm glad it's working the way i wanted it to. thank you for your advice.
